God wants you wealthy

In the following Scripture, notice carefully the words "is," "able," "abound" and "sufficiency."

2 Cor 9:8
8 And God is able to make all grace abound toward you; that ye, always having all sufficiency in all things, may abound to every good work: (KJV)

This verse seems to give this meaning: "God" is the subject of the sentence. Second, "is" appears to function as a linking verb. Third, "able" appears to function as an adjective describing one of the characteristics of God.

The Greek text, however, gives it a totally different meaning. "God" is the subject of the sentence. "Is" does not function as a linking verb. As a matter of fact, "is" does not appear in the Greek text at all. It was added by the translators to smooth out the meaning to make it easier to understand what this verse actually says.

 Furthermore, "able" is not an adjective at all. It is a verb that means "power." Our word "dynamite" comes from this same Greek word for "power."

"Dynamite" in this verse is a present, active, indicative verb. "Present tense" shows us that the dynamiting was continuously going on in present time. "Active" demonstrates that God is the one doing the dynamiting. "Dynamite" is also in the Indicative Mood which demonstrates means what is actually happening. It does not pertain to something that might happen. The Indicative pertains to what is really happening now.

God wants you wealthy

Look at the word “abound” in the above verse. It’s used twice and both times, it means to overflow to the point of abundance. Bauer, Arndt and Gingrich use the following expressions from their lexicon to describe the word abound: (1.) be extremely rich (2.) be rich of or in something (3.) have ample means for every enterprise (4.) make extremely rich etc.

W. E. Vine (Expository Dictionary of New Testament Words) implies that it means to overflow to the point of making one extremely rich or wealthy.

Now look at the word "sufficient." This word means to "defend against adversities cause by lack." Lack of money brings about all kinds of adversities. In the context of the above verse, we can easily see that God wants to deliver you from any and all adversities caused by the lack of money.

Now from all the above, we see in a flash that God wants to make us extremely wealthy. Why? God wants to make us extremely wealthy for two reasons: First, He makes us wealthy so that we have no lack at all. Second, He makes us wealthy so that we can have enough to make every good work of His wealthy also.
